HTML5视频网站实现与源码分析

版权申诉
5星 · 超过95%的资源 19 下载量 173 浏览量 更新于2024-11-06 3 收藏 178.7MB ZIP 举报
资源摘要信息:"HTML实现视频网站(源码)的知识点详解" 1. HTML基础与结构 HTML是构建网页的骨架,用于定义网页的结构和内容。在实现视频网站时,基本的HTML标签(如`<!DOCTYPE html>`, `<html>`, `<head>`, `<title>`, `<body>`等)是必须掌握的基础知识。本资源会涉及如何使用这些标签来创建网页的基本结构。 2. 视频播放器的集成 视频网站的核心功能之一是视频播放。实现这一功能,通常需要集成HTML5的`<video>`标签,它可以嵌入视频文件到网页中,并提供了播放、暂停、音量控制等基本功能。此外,也可能包含对不同视频格式的兼容性处理,如MP4、WebM或Ogg格式。 3. 视频列表和播放控制 为了提供更丰富的用户体验,视频网站通常会提供一个视频列表供用户选择。在本资源中,会介绍如何通过HTML和可能的JavaScript代码来创建视频列表,并实现选择播放集数的功能。同时,还会涉及到如何实现自动播放下一集的功能,以及相关的前端控制逻辑。 4. CSS样式应用 在HTML代码中,直接展示的视频网站可能缺乏美观。为了让网站看起来更加专业和吸引人,CSS样式将被广泛应用。本资源会涉及一些基础的CSS样式使用,如何为视频播放器设置样式,以及对整个网站的视觉布局进行优化。 5. JavaScript交互逻辑 为了让视频网站更加动态和具有交互性,JavaScript是不可或缺的一部分。资源中可能会包含JavaScript代码,用于处理视频播放的逻辑,如动态更新视频列表、控制播放器行为、处理播放状态等。 6. 独立代码模块 资源中提到“代码独立,可以直接使用”,这意味着提供的源码可能被设计为模块化,以便在不同的项目中容易地被重用和集成。了解如何构建和使用独立的代码模块,对于开发可维护和可扩展的网站是十分重要的。 7. 在线预览与本地部署 资源提供了在线效果演示地址,这有助于学习者理解视频网站是如何在实际环境中运行的。同时,学习者也可以尝试将源码下载到本地环境中进行部署和测试,了解在本地服务器上运行网站的过程。 8. HTML5和Web新技术 实现视频网站不仅仅是学习HTML,还可能涉及到HTML5的新特性,例如Canvas、WebSocket等,这些技术可能用于增强网站功能,如实时字幕显示、直播视频流处理等。 总结,本资源将为学习者提供一个视频网站实现的完整案例,从基础的HTML结构到前端设计的美化,再到视频播放的实现和用户交互的优化,每个环节都可能包含在源码中。通过学习和实践这些知识点,学习者能够更好地掌握创建动态网站的技术,并在此基础上完成自己的项目任务。